Output 7d300ec44af4a171a36fb4c12021850c3342d5abc91430a01aea0c2072f992c8:0

value
1272792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c518865e3c6d94f805c71e55115d2f3ddf0653d OP_EQUAL
address
3EUxCQ58x3EaHc5JeKJKp5FM5y8rqV24dT
transaction
7d300ec44af4a171a36fb4c12021850c3342d5abc91430a01aea0c2072f992c8
spent
true